Gimp 2.8.4 for Precise or Slacko or Raring |
|
This version of Gimp will run only on Precise puppy linux,
PreciseNOP or Slacko or Raring.
It won't work on distributions like Wheezy or Wary.
I recompiled to make the foreign locales work. You must install the
NLS package of course to show a foreign language menu!!
I don't know the benefits of this version, but
it's stable and will export to many image formats.
You can choose either an SFS or a PET file to install.
Don't install both!

I finally discovered what was causing problem with sfs file.
launchpad.net stores libgegl and libbabl libraries in
/usr/lib/i386-linux-gnu/
Fixed and tested on raring distro.
